Pros

decent pay, multiple chances for overtime which was time and a half. During high volume or holidays overtime was time and half plus an extra amount that was determined by management

Cons

Have to meet a specific quota in 2/3 hour intervals. Sometimes this was difficult if you could not find the medication because a coworker had it or it was out of stock, another problem was having the correct supplies readily available, at the time they were down dishwashers so getting supplies took extra time and you really couldn't work if you didn’t have the right equipment.

Pros

There is real, meaningful progress happening at Wedgewood Chandler. Leadership has introduced a Career Pathing Program that gives employees a clear framework for growth defined role levels, qualification criteria, and individualized development planning. It takes the guesswork out of advancement and gives people something concrete to work toward. Scheduling has also improved significantly. The move to a structured, rotating overtime schedule means employees now have advance visibility into when their overtime falls, making it much easier to plan personal time around work commitments. It reflects a genuine effort to build a healthier balance between operational needs and employee wellbeing. This is a team that is moving in the right direction, and it shows.

Cons

Like any organization in transition, some legacy challenges around workload and communication are still being worked through. Change takes time, and not every process has caught up to the new direction yet. But the trajectory is clearly positive.
